全国用户服务热线

您的位置:主页 > 最新动态

摊位管理系统的跨平台开发与集成方案

发布日期:2025-03-27 浏览:7次

随着科技的发展和市场的需求,越来越多的企业和机构开始关注和使用摊位管理系统。摊位管理系统不仅可以提高工作效率,减少人力成本,还可以提供更好的服务质量和用户体验。然而,由于各个平台之间的差异性,如操作系统、硬件设备等,使得开发和集成摊位管理系统变得复杂化。因此,跨平台开发和集成方案变得至关重要。

跨平台开发是指在不同的操作系统上开发软件程序的能力。目前,市面上主要有两种主流的跨平台开发框架:React Native和Flutter。React Native是由Facebook推出的开源框架,可以使用JavaScript和React.js来开发Native应用程序,支持iOS和Android两个主流操作系统。Flutter是由Google推出的开源框架,使用Dart语言编写,在iOS和Android上能够构建高度定制的用户界面。这两种框架都具有良好的跨平台开发能力,在易用性和性能上都有不错的表现。

在选择跨平台开发框架时,需要综合考虑团队的技术背景、项目的需求和预算等因素。如果团队成员对JavaScript和React.js熟悉,可以选择React Native进行开发;如果团队成员对Dart语言有经验,可以选择Flutter进行开发。此外,还需要考虑项目的复杂性和性能需求,对于一些简单的应用,React Native可能更合适;对于一些需要高度定制和复杂逻辑的应用,Flutter可能更适用。

另外,跨平台开发并不仅仅是开发应用程序,还需要将系统集成到各个平台。系统集成包括但不限于应用程序安装、配置、数据传输等。在摊位管理系统中,常见的集成功能包括与地图服务的集成、用户数据的同步等。为了实现这些功能,可以使用开源的或者第三方的软件库和服务。例如,集成地图可以使用高德地图或者百度地图的API,将摊位的位置信息展示在地图上;用户数据的同步可以使用云服务,如阿里云或者腾讯云,实现数据的同步和备份。

综上所述,摊位管理系统的跨平台开发和集成方案是一个复杂而又关键的问题。开发团队需要根据项目需求和技术背景选择合适的跨平台开发框架,如React Native或者Flutter。同时,还需要借助第三方库和服务来实现系统的集成,如地图服务和云服务等。只有合理选择和应用这些方案,才能够开发出高效、稳定、易用的摊位管理系统,为用户提供更好的服务体验。
主页 QQ 微信 电话
展开